Visiting a Planned Parenthood Health Center
If you are looking for a convenient and affordable option for a first trimester ultrasound, consider visiting your nearest Planned Parenthood health center. These centers offer free or low-cost ultrasound services, regardless of whether you have insurance coverage. By choosing Planned Parenthood, you can access quality care without financial strain.

Community Health Clinics
Community health clinics play a vital role in providing healthcare services to underserved populations, including prenatal care. Many community clinics offer ultrasound services for pregnant individuals, including those in the first trimester of pregnancy. These clinics prioritize affordability and accessibility, making them a suitable choice for families seeking ultrasound services.

Importance of Timely Ultrasound Screening
Receiving a first trimester ultrasound is a key step in monitoring the health and development of your baby during early pregnancy. Early ultrasound screenings can detect potential issues, confirm the viability of the pregnancy, and provide reassurance to expectant parents. By prioritizing timely ultrasound screenings, you can stay informed about your pregnancy progress and address any concerns promptly.
